09:10 — Dario finally caught the leaked file descriptors in the Pemmet uploader: every retry opened a temp file and never closed it on the error path. We'd been restarting hosts nightly as a band-aid, which is why nobody noticed for weeks. The fix shipped same day; the patched build is identified just below.

pipeline stamp: htk9_ce63042d9

**Vendor Note: Telemetry Compression via Densifold**

For future maintainers: our telemetry payloads are compressed using the Densifold codec, licensed from Orrenbach Labs. The license covers server-side use only; do not embed the codec in client builds. Compression ratios are contractually guaranteed at 6:1 on our schema, and regressions below that threshold qualify for service credits. Keep the benchmark suite running monthly to preserve that claim. For licensing or performance disputes, contact their account team at the address below.

pager mailbox: lamdor_julath_belius@halixforge.local

Subject: SquatSentry cut-over complete — notes for future maintainers

The migration of SquatSentry, our typo-squatting package scanner, to the new worker cluster finished last night. Scan latency is back to baseline and the backlog cleared within two hours. All legacy nodes are decommissioned; please don't reference the old registry mirror anywhere. For the record, the production service now runs with the following configuration.

settings of fafog-haduf:
ZORIX_PIN=4648
ZORIX_METRICS_HOST=metrics.zorix.paliqsys.corp
ZORIX_LOG_LEVEL=info
ZORIX_TENANT=druix